Goods and services

ClassDescriptionStatusFirst use
009Downloadable computer software for use in electronically trading, storing, sending, receiving, accepting and transmitting digital currency, and managing digital currency payment and exchange transactions; downloadable computer software for processing electronic payments and for transferring funds to and from others; downloadable authentication software for controlling access to and communications with computers and computer networksACTIVEMay 12, 2022
036Currency exchange services; on-line real-time currency trading; cash management, namely, electronic transfers of funds in the nature of electronic cash equivalents; electronic funds transfer featuring digital currency for transferrable electronic cash equivalent units having a specified cash value; financial services, namely, electronic funds transfer; providing a wide variety of payment and financial services, namely, credit card payment processing services, credit cards authorization services, providing personal lines of credit, electronic payment services involving electronic processing and subsequent transmission of bill payment data, bill payment services featuring guaranteed payment delivery, all conducted via a global communications network; credit card and debit card transaction processing services; bill payment services; bill payment services provided via mobile applications; credit card payment processing services; merchant services, namely, payment processing services featuring virtual currency; financial services, namely, providing information in the field of finance via the internet and providing on line stored value accounts in an electronic environment; monetary exchangeACTIVEMay 12, 2022
042Providing temporary use of online non-downloadable software for use in electronically trading, storing, sending, receiving, accepting and transmitting digital currency, non-fungible tokens, crypto collectibles, and for managing digital currency payment and exchange transactions; providing temporary use of on-line non-downloadable software for processing electronic payments; providing temporary use of on-line non-downloadable authentication software for controlling access to and communications with computers and computer networksACTIVEMay 12, 2022

Prosecution history

Latest event (GNRN): A non-final Office Action means the USPTO examining attorney has raised at least one issue with your trademark application but has not made a final decision. You usually have three months to respond with arguments, amendments, or evidence. Missing the deadline can abandon the application.
